Elmira College Women’s Ice Hockey Releases 2015-16 Schedule

2015-16 Women's Ice Hockey Schedule

Elmira, NY --
After a runner-up finish in the 2015 NCAA Division III Women's Ice Hockey Tournament, the Elmira College women's ice hockey team is eager to begin the 2015-16 season.  Elmira will play in 25 regular season games, including a pair of tournaments at the East-West Hockey Classic and the UNO Chicago Grill Cardinal-Panther Classic.
 
Elmira begins the 2015-16 campaign on Saturday, October 31st, at the campus of Norwich University in Northfield, VT, at the ultra-competitive East-West Hockey Classic.  The Soaring Eagles open tournament play on Haloween against Adrian College, a team that ended last season with a No. 6 USCHO national ranking.  EC will then take on the either Norwich or Plattsburgh State the following day. 
 
On Friday, November 13th, the Soaring Eagles will play in their home opener, which will also be their ECAC West Conference opener, against SUNY Cortland at the Murray Athletic Center at 7:00 p.m.  The following day, Elmira will face Cortland again but this time at the Red Dragons' home rink at 2:00 p.m.
 
The following weekend features Elmira against Utica College in another home-and-home series, beginning with a Saturday, November 21st matchup at the domes.  Utica will then host Elmira the following day.
 
The Soaring Eagles will then take a short break from conference play to compete in the UNO Chicago Grill Cardinal-Panther Classic, one of the nation's premier regular season tournaments.  Elmira opens play against host Middlebury College on Friday, November 27th, before taking on Gustavus Adolphus College the following afternoon.  Both Middlebury and Gustavus Adolphus finished the 2014-15 campaign ranked inside the top 10 in the national USCHO coaches poll.
 
Following play at the Cardinal-Panther Classic, Elmira resumes their ECAC West schedule with a pair of road games against the Bears of SUNY Potsdam on December 5th and 6th.  The two games against Potsdam mark the final contests of 2015 for the Soaring Eagles.
 
Elmira opens the New Year with five consecutive home contests, beginning on Saturday, January 2nd, with EC's first home contest in nearly a month and a half, as the Soaring Eagles welcome non-conference opponent Williams College to the Murray Athletic Center for a 3:00 p.m. showdown. 
 
Seven days later, Elmira will face Norwich University in what could be their first or second matchup of the season, depending on what happens at the East-West Classic at the beginning of the season. 
 
Three days later, the Soaring Eagles will play in their lone Tuesday night contest of the season, as the Soaring Eagles take on Amherst College on January 12th at 7:00 p.m.  That same weekend, Elmira will re-open conference play with back-to-back games against Neumann University.  The games against the Knights mark the end of five straight home contests.
 
The following weekend, Elmira travels to Pittsburgh, PA for another conference series, this one featuring the Soaring Eagles and the Cougars of Chatham University. 
 
Hockey fans would be wise to circle the next two dates on their calendars as the Soaring Eagles face Plattsburgh State in a rematch of last year's NCAA Division III Women's Ice Hockey Championship game.  The rivalry between two of the nation's top programs continues on Saturday, January 30th, through Sunday the 31st.  Both games will be played at 3:00 p.m.
 
Elmira will then face Buffalo State in another ECAC West home-and-home series, starting with a Friday, February 5th matchup against the Bengals in Buffalo, NY.  EC will then head back home to Pine Valley, NY to face Buffalo State on February 6th. 
 
Another home-and-home series is scheduled the following weekend as Elmira faces second year program, William Smith College, in back-to-back games on February 13th and 14th.  The game on the 13th marks Elmira's final regular season home contest of the season, while the contest on the 14th will be played away from home in Geneva, NY.
 
Elmira will then conclude the 2015-16 regular season with back-to-back games against Oswego State on February 19th and 20th.
